我有两台 Cent OS 7 服务器,我正尝试将目录从主机服务器挂载到客户端服务器。我希望它在启动时自动挂载。
在我的主机(hostmachine.local)上,我设置了一个用户并授予该用户 sudo 权限。
我在客户端计算机上设置了一个 ssh 密钥,并将其与我在主机上创建的 sudo 用户关联。然后我将以下内容添加到我的/etc/fstab
文件中...
sshfs#[email protected]:/var/www/vhosts /mnt/hostdir fuse _netdev,IdentityFile=~/.ssh/id_rsa,allow_other 0 0
当我重新启动机器时,它会安装并且我可以/var/www/vhosts
从客户端读取目录的内容(通过/mnt/hostdir
),但是当我尝试写入已安装的目录时,我收到权限被拒绝错误。